How to fill out nutrient cycling sampling analysis

How to fill out nutrient cycling sampling analysis:
01
Begin by gathering all necessary equipment and materials needed for the analysis, including sampling containers, labels, gloves, and any specific tools or instruments required.
02
Determine the appropriate locations for sampling by conducting a thorough site assessment. This may involve identifying key areas of interest, such as nutrient-rich zones or areas of potential nutrient depletion.
03
Once the sampling locations are selected, ensure that they are properly marked or recorded for accurate documentation and future reference.
04
Follow established protocols for collecting samples. This may involve taking soil samples at various depths, collecting plant or tissue samples, or collecting water samples from specific locations.
05
Use proper sampling techniques to ensure representative and unbiased samples. This may include random sampling or systematic sampling methods, depending on the objective of the analysis.
06
Take the necessary precautions to prevent contamination during the sampling process. This may involve wearing gloves, using clean tools, and avoiding contact with any potential sources of contamination.
07
Label each sample container with relevant information, such as the sampling location, date, and any specific characteristics or conditions that need to be considered during analysis.
08
Transport the samples to the laboratory as quickly as possible, following any specific handling or storage instructions provided. This may involve keeping the samples cool or preventing exposure to direct sunlight.
09
Provide all necessary information and documentation to the laboratory, including any specific analysis requests or instructions.
10
Wait for the analysis results to be provided by the laboratory, and interpret the findings accordingly to understand the nutrient cycling dynamics and identify any potential issues or areas of improvement.
